Travelling for Beach in India in the month of August

Beaches have to be the best destination for relaxing vacations. Whether you are looking for a romantic couple vacay, or a fun family vacay, or a laid back trip with friends, a beach destination is always a solution. From bright loose sands, to beautiful rock formations, to mesmerizing fauna and vegetation, beaches serve you with the perfect vacation packages. Also, be ready to enjoy some lip-smacking drinks and delightful dishes.

Travelling within your country is always a great option before moving out to an international destination. You get to save on a lot of budget most of the times and also save on a lot of travelling time. Also, you don’t need to worry much about the food, the climate or the culture. And India being the land of heritages, history, culture and geography will never fail to suprise you with its charm.

August has some unexplored sights for you to catch up with your holiday goals by breaking the monotony of your traffic jam stories. And you will come back rejuvenated with some productivity-spiking experiences.

FAQs -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best things to do at a beach?

Dip in the ocean, soak in the sun, enjoy water sports ranging from shell-hunting to jogging, take long walks on the beach, splash and surf in the water, watch the sunset, have a picnic, build castles, etc.

What makes India good for tourism?

India has the best of colourful landscapes, fantastic sightseeing and much more, and it is relatively cheaper than the rest of the world. The warm Indian hospitality is known throughout the globe. Also, India has so many cuisines to satisfy any kind of a traveller. Even when it comes to shopping, India never disappoints!

Why is it recommended to travel in August?

Apart from the pleasant rain showers, August offers excellent travel discounts, fantastic weather, lovely views and lesser crowds.
